It’s the world’s largest killer.

Yet hundreds of thousands gloss over the specter of coronary heart illness, assuming they’re going to someway keep away from the inevitable penalties of an unhealthy way of life.

But, for these eager to learn about their danger, there’s an NHS take a look at that may assist.

The software compares your actual age in opposition to your coronary heart age, just by asking questions on your well being. 

All it’s essential do is reply just a few questions.

It quizzes folks on their historical past of heart-related sicknesses and whether or not they have diabetes, arthritis or kidney illness. 

The calculator additionally requires your age, peak, weight and postcode earlier than additionally asking if in case you have ever smoked and what your blood strain is. 

Using a particular algorithm, the calculator then provides you an age in your coronary heart. 

If you’re a wholesome 30-year-old who has by no means smoked and has a low physique mass index (BMI), your coronary heart age will almost certainly be 30. 

But if in case you have a historical past of coronary heart illness, hypertension or ldl cholesterol or smoke that quantity begins to creep up. 

For instance, a 45-year-old girl who doesn’t have heart problems and who smokes lower than 10 cigarettes a day can have a coronary heart age of 46. 

But, if somebody of this demographic quits smoking, they might lose as much as three years off their coronary heart age, the NHS says.

A 60-year-old white male who does not have heart problems, smokes 20 a day, is six foot and 16 stone and has arthritis and a hypertension, may have a coronary heart age of about 68.

The NHS quiz says in the event that they give up smoking, they might enhance their coronary heart age by round eight years and an extra three years by reducing weight.   

The quiz additionally bases its age calculation on ldl cholesterol and blood strain in addition to issues similar to weight and smoking habits. 

A blood strain studying is taken into account wholesome whether it is between 90/60mmHg and 120/80mmHg.

High blood strain, or hypertension, doesn’t all the time have noticeable signs, in response to the quiz. 

But whether it is left untreated it will probably improve your danger of coronary heart assaults and strokes.  

The quiz makes way of life strategies to assist decrease hypertension together with reducing weight, consuming much less salt, exercising frequently and chopping again on alcohol and caffeine.  

But in case your blood strain is excessive a GP might offer you drugs to assist decrease it. 

Cholesterol is taken into account wholesome whether it is 5mmol/l or under and it may be improved by being bodily lively and consuming the precise meals. 

THE CAUSES OF STROKE

There are two main sorts of stroke: 

1. ISCHEMIC STROKE 

An ischemic stroke – which accounts for 80 per cent of strokes – happens when there’s a blockage in a blood vessel that stops blood from reaching a part of the mind.

2. HEMORRHAGIC STROKE 

The extra uncommon, a hemorrhagic stroke, happens when a blood vessel bursts, flooding a part of the mind with an excessive amount of blood whereas depriving different areas of ample blood provide.

It may be the results of an AVM, or arteriovenous malformation (an irregular cluster of blood vessels), within the mind.

Thirty % of subarachnoid hemorrhage victims die earlier than reaching the hospital. An extra 25 per cent die inside 24 hours. And 40 per cent of survivors die inside every week.

RISK FACTORS

Age, hypertension, smoking, weight problems, sedentary way of life, diabetes, atrial fibrillation, household historical past, and historical past of a earlier stroke or TIA (a mini stroke) are all danger elements for having a stroke.

SYMPTOMS OF A STROKE

  • Sudden numbness or weak spot of the face, arm or leg, particularly on one aspect of the physique
  • Sudden confusion, bother talking or understanding
  • Sudden bother seeing or blurred imaginative and prescient in a single or each eyes
  • Sudden bother strolling, dizziness, lack of stability or coordination
  • Sudden extreme headache with no recognized trigger

OUTCOMES 

Of the roughly three out of 4 individuals who survive a stroke, many can have life-long disabilities.

This consists of issue strolling, speaking, consuming, and finishing on a regular basis duties or chores. 

TREATMENT 

Both are doubtlessly deadly, and sufferers require surgical procedure or a drug known as tPA (tissue plasminogen activator) inside three hours to avoid wasting them.
